Har Day
Painting
ca. 1850 - ca. 1870 (made)
ca. 1850 - ca. 1870 (made)
Artist/Maker | |
Place of origin |
Painting, paint on ivory, a miniature portrait of the Rani (queen) of Ranjit Singh, Har Day. Three quarter view, head and shoulders, facing left, against a pale blue background. She wears a purple veil and green dress and leans against a red cushion.
